Madras High Court orders CBI probe into Rs 5,800 crore illegal sand mining in Tamil Nadu

Chennai, 17/2: The Madras High Court on Monday ordered a CBI probe into the massive alleged illegal beach sand mining to the tune of Rs 5,832 crore by private mining companies in the coastal districts of Tirunelveli, Tutocorin and Kanyakumari in Tamil Nadu and wanted among others, the agency to investigate the role of officials…

Shallow earthquake jolts Delhi, NCR; PM Modi says stay calm, alert for possible aftershocks

New Delhi, 17/2: Strong tremors were felt in the national capital and adjoining regions as an earthquake of 4.0 magnitude struck the region early on Monday. There were no immediate reports of any damage or injuries. Prime Minister Narendra Modi urged people in the region to stay calm and follow safety precautions while keeping alert…
